btomlin Simple, untwist your string. The more twists the more rotation. Any string twisted to adjust draw length will twist. If you need more than 5 or 6 twists to adjust, you should make the adjustments for draw on the cam setting. I shoot a Protec with LX Pro limbs. That's 48" axle to axle with 3 counter clockwise twists. I'm a right hand fingers shooter and as I draw the sting the tab will roll against the twist. If I'm on the string with my tab consistently the peep will be perfect. If I grab or roll to much, the peep will be a touch off center. This gives me a reference to make sure my tab and draw is the same shot after shot. At rest to full draw my peep rotates 1/4 turn consistently.
